The Recitals set forth above are true and correct and are <br />incorporated herein by reference. In addition, the City Council finds that the <br />Application is consistent with the City of Colton General Plan and Zoning Ordinance. <br />The approximate 1.95 -acre project Subject Site is designated "High Density Residential" <br />in the City's General Plan. It is also zoned R-3 (Multiple -Family Residential) on the City <br />Zoning Map. While the Project exceeds these density factors, the density is permitted by <br />virtue of the fact that the Applicant will make all of the units available to low-income <br />households at an affordable rent. Under California law (Government Code, Section <br />65915) whenever an applicant makes a percentage of units available for rent or sale to <br />low-income households, they are entitled to additional density in the project. Further, <br />development of this Project will assist the City in meeting its housing goals as defined in <br />the City's Housing Element and Redevelopment Plans. <br />SECTION 2. Based on the entire record before the City Council, all <br />written and oral evidence presented, and the findings made in this Resolution, the City <br />Council hereby approves File Index No. DAP (REVISED) -000-668 subject to all <br />conditions of approval, including recordation of the Density Bonus and Regulatory <br />Covenant. <br />SECTION 3. California Government Code Section 65915 provides that a <br />city cannot apply any development standard that will have the effect of precluding the <br />construction of a density bonus project at the densities proposed. In such cases, the city <br />must waive or modify the suggested standard unless such a waiver would have a <br />specific, adverse impact upon health, safety or the physical environment.
